Transponder Keys
Transponder keys are one of the most popular kinds of car keys available there, and with good reason. They offer a lot of advantages over other keys, such as the fact that they are extremely difficult to duplicate and will work with your vehicle's immobilizer system. It's important to remember that a non-transponder key may be the best option in certain scenarios.
Transponders are tiny microchips which are embedded into your car's key head made of plastic. When you insert a transponder into the ignition of your vehicle it sends a signal to the computer. The computer checks to ensure that the key car repair is authentic and then allows the engine to start.
It's important to store your transponder keys in a secure place. It's also important to ensure that it's not exposed to extreme temperatures or humidity for long periods of time, as this could damage the chip. You should also keep spares in case you lose the original transponder key.
Transponder chips for a while. Most cars built after 1998 have transponder chips. They help reduce car theft and provide peace of assurance that only you are able to start your car. But that doesn't make them invincible. Some car thieves are savvy enough to wire cars even if they're equipped with transponders.
There are a variety of car keys. But, most of them are equipped with transponders, and must be programmed by a professional. If you have the original, you can do it yourself. However, it's always better to hire a professional.
Some companies are also able to make replacement transponder keys, but without the original. This is not always true and you should seek out a locksmith that specializes in transponder keys to make certain. They can give you accurate information about your specific type of car.
Key Fobs
Key fobs are miniature remote controls that allow you to operate your car remote key repair near me's windows and doors without turning your keys. Key fobs of the present often come with upgraded features, such as an alarm button that activates the alarm system of the car, attracting attention and deterring potential thieves.
The majority of fobs are powered by small batteries. These batteries are coin-shaped and are available in hardware stores, online retailers, and big-box retailers. It's easy to change the battery; just snap the two parts of the key fob in a nut and replace the old one with a brand new one. There are step-by-step directions in the owner's manual or at the dealer service department.
Fobs use cryptographic methods to encrypt signals that they transmit to the receiver inside your vehicle. This blocks hacking, cloning and spoofing. In this case, attackers record the signal and replay it to unlock or even start your car key fob repair.
Modern key fobs may have a feature that lets you track the location of your car from your phone in case you lose it. When you hit the lock or unlock buttons on the fob it transmits a signal to a mobile network. A specific app on your phone will then translate this signal into the location of the car which you can view on a map displayed on your smartphone.
Even older key fobs might come with security features to ensure your car's security. Certain fobs, like they have an "rolling-code" that generates a distinct encrypted signal each time you press the button. These rolling codes make it harder for attackers to replicate or spoof signals, and also prevent attackers from knowing the key you're using to control your car.
Some key fobs are available at auto parts stores and other retailers, while others can only be purchased at the dealership. This is because the dealership has the knowledge and expertise to create replacement fobs that are suited to the vehicle.
